“Old age should be viewed as an achievement and a natural stage of life with its own merits, wisdom and beauty”. This was just one of the points mentioned by MEC for Social Services MR G.H. Akharwaray in his opening speech at the Yebo Gogo Party held in Kimberley in June 2005.

The aim of the party, which is part of a national competition to donate money to charity, was to enable pensioners from the Kimberley region to have an exciting day out, with a delicious luncheon and a fun-filled day of entertainment.  Among the guests from Resthaven Old Age Home, Galeshewe Day Care Centre and Stillerwee Old Age Home were Councilor’s Agnes Ntlangula and Selina Nkomo from the Solplaatje Municipality, who attended on behalf of his Worship, Ald T.P. Lenyibi, the Mayor of Kimberley.

Activities for the day included a mini concert by 23 five and six year old children from the Smiley Kids Choir in Kimberley, bingo games hosted by Jaco de Wet, music by Star Sound, and an afternoon stage production by the Gravel Road Theater filled with cabaret, drama, funny stories, poetry, movement, dance, music and singing all especially choreographed to appeal to the guests.
